PER 11: Advanced Persian I
3.00 Credits
Long Island University-C W Post Campus
This course is part of Critical Languages Program. This course cannot be used to make up foreign language entrance deficiencies or to fulfill Core requirements. Course work includes at least thirty hours of in class tutoring by a heritage speaker and successful completion of a final examination administered by a different heritage speaker. Prerequisite of PER 4 is required.

PHI 10: Life and Death
3.00 Credits
Long Island University-C W Post Campus
This course covers fundamental philosophical questions about life and death. Topics may include the following: surrogate motherhood and reproductive technologies, abortion, euthanasia, suicide, artificial prolongation of life and the concept of death with dignity, immortality and the concept of the soul.

PHI 13: Ethics and Society
3.00 Credits
Long Island University-C W Post Campus
What does it mean to be a good person? What are our ethical obligations to other individuals and to society as a whole? Is there such a thing as moral truth, or is morality 'relative' to individuals or societies? This course is an introduction to ethics, the branch of philosophy that addresses such questions.

PHI 14: Symbolic Logic
3.00 Credits
Long Island University-C W Post Campus
This course is an introduction to symbolic logic. The study of two important logical instruments- the methods truth-tables and the formal methods of proving the validity and invalidity of arguments will help students to sharpen their critical reasoning skills. The logic course is of special interest to prelaw, science and business majors and students who expect to take additional courses in philosophy.
